Caring for a Wrapped Bouquet of Flowers

  • Clean and fill a vase with slightly cool to lukewarm water
  • Mix in the flower preservative provided according to the instructions on the packet
  • Remove flowers from wrapper and remove any water tubes that may be on some stems
  • Preferably with pruning shears, cut each stem (including previously tubed stems), and immediately place in water
  • Follow instructions below: Caring for Flowers in a Vase to keep them fresh longer

Caring for Flowers in a Vase

  • Always keep the water level close to full
  • About every 2 to 3 days, change the water, re-cut all stems and immediately place back in water
  • Always remove wilting or dead leaves, stems, or flowers from the arrangement
  • Also, when the water gets cloudy it’s time to change it

Caring for Flowers in a basket or Other Containers

  • Again, always keep the water level close to full, be sure to add water to the inner liner
  • Always remove wilting or dead leaves, stems, or flowers from the arrangement

A Few extra Tips

  • A gardener’s pruning shears are an excellent tool to cut stems with
  • Keep flowers in a cool environment whenever possible
  • Remove any below-water foliage, they can rot quickly and spoil the water

What to Avoid

  • Keep flowers away from extreme temperatures and drafts which can dry them out quickly
  • Keep fresh flowers away from direct sunlight, they will overheat and wilt quickly
  • Keep flowers away from cooking stoves and electronics which give off heat
  • Keep flowers away from fresh fruit, they emit Ethylene gas which quickly ages flowers
  • Try to avoid cutting stems with a scissor as it may crush stems instead of cut them
